Anaja's usage pattern, beyond the headline number
Divide Anaja's SSA record in two at 2005 and the more recent half accounts for 44% of all births, the earlier half the remaining 56%, a genuinely balanced usage pattern. Its calmest year was 2013, with only 5 births recorded -- set against the 2001 peak of 22, that's the full swing in one name's fortunes.

Anaja by decade
2000s is the heaviest window (143 births, 64% of the file).
2000s was Anaja's strongest decade.
143 babies received the name during that ten-year window, about 64% of all-time use.
